First Early Announcements of 2026-27 State Scholars Completed
ISAC is pleased to announce that the 2026-27 State Scholar Program (SSP) early announcement processing cycle has begun for those high schools that have chosen to participate. Scholars whose high schools participate in the early announcement process can benefit by including this academic achievement on their college admission applications.
- High schools for whom Scholars are named may check an individual student's status by viewing the "Selected for State Scholar" column on the "Student Results" screen within the SSP system.
- A "Finalist" report may be generated via the SSP system. Instructions for generating this report are provided in the SSP Online Processing User Guide.
Weekly Announcement of State Scholars
From this point forward, a weekly announcement of 2026-27 State Scholars will be made for students attending high schools that have submitted sixth semester data with no unresolved discrepancies and have chosen to participate in the early announcement process. Results for these high schools will be reflected in the SSP system on Wednesday mornings.
Reminders
- Although the October 31, 2025 deadline for the first round of early announcements has passed, ISAC will continue to accept sixth semester data until the final round of announcements has been completed (anticipated for early December).
- Submit your students' sixth semester data as soon as possible to make sure they are included as 2026-27 State Scholars are determined throughout the fall.
- Students with an Illinois Standard Test Score (ISTS) of 30 or higher are automatically designated as State Scholars; students with an ISTS lower than 30, but whose Weighted Selection Score (WSS) is greater than or equal to the cutoff score of 47, are also designated as State Scholars.
- Specific details about the selection formula are provided on the State Scholar Selection Process page.
- High schools choose whether to include their eligible students for consideration in the early processing cycle.
- Checking the "Run Selection" box (located on the "State Scholar Program: Search By School: Results" screen of the SSP system) allows the high school's students to be included for consideration in the next round of 2026-27 State Scholar announcements.
- For high schools that submit sixth semester data via an Excel spreadsheet, the "Run Selection" checkbox becomes available to check after ISAC has reviewed the file.
- Once ISAC has reviewed the file, an email is sent to the high school's Primary Administrator (principal) and the School Contact (as listed in the SSP system's "State Scholar Program: Search by School: Results" screen) to indicate the "Run Selection" box is available to check.
- Before checking the box, be sure to review all submitted student data for accuracy.
- Students whose high schools submit sixth semester data, but choose not to participate in the early announcement process, will be considered for State Scholar designation when the last announcement round takes place in late fall.
- A sample press release, which can assist schools in announcing State Scholars, will be provided at the ISAC website after final announcements have been made.
- In past years, ISAC has mailed congratulatory letters directly to State Scholars. Unfortunately, recent changes in ACT and SAT data prevent us from obtaining mailing addresses for some students.
- In the current processing cycle (for students entering college in 2026-27), ISAC will print and mail State Scholar congratulatory letters to participating high schools after the final round of announcements has been completed.
- We ask schools to distribute the letters to State Scholars in a manner that works best for them.
- Beginning with next year's cycle (for students entering college in 2027–28), ISAC will no longer print and mail congratulatory letters.
- High schools will access student notifications through the SSP system and share them with their State Scholars.
- Detailed instructions for accessing student notifications will be provided when this functionality becomes available.
